Pros
The company has attracted genuinely talented people across all teams, and at its best, the atmosphere has been collaborative and supportive. The product and technical environment is strong, remote flexibility is available for support teams, and the work itself tends to be interesting, with real room to experiment and push boundaries.
Cons
The past two years have been difficult, and the lack of visible recovery has taken a real toll on morale and trust. While the company champions AI adoption, the execution has felt heavy-handed, with strategic decisions and individual workflows being shaped by people who may not fully understand the roles involved. For an organization that brands itself as people-first, internal communications and HR practices (particularly around offboarding) don't always reflect that. And while there are strong individuals across the business, some managers would benefit from greater emotional intelligence, clearer communication, and more realistic goal-setting.
